Something rattled South Jersey on Thursday.
Residents throughout the southern half of the state wondered at first whether the rumblings were caused by an earthquake but the U.S. Geological Survey said that's not what happened and attributed the tremors to a sonic boom.
Though skeptics remained after that announcement, the U.S. Navy has now said it was conducting routine tests off the East Coast that may have resulted in sonic booms.
